There are discussions for Alphabet's Google to spend hundreds of millions of dollars in Character.AI, according to two people informed on the situation who spoke with Reuters. The rapidly expanding artificial intelligence chatbot firm is looking for funding to train models and meet customer demand.


The investment will strengthen the current partnership character; it may be structured as convertible notes, according to a third source.AI already has a relationship with Google via which it trains models using Tensor Processing Units (TPUs) and Google cloud services.


Comment inquiries were not answered by Google or Character AI.


Character was founded by Noam Shazeer and Daniel De Freitas, two former Google workers.AI enables users to create their own chatbots and AI helpers and converse with virtual representations of popular celebrities like Billie Eilish or anime characters. Although it is free to use, there is a subscription option available for $9.99 per month for customers who would like bypass the virtual line and speak with a chatbot.


Morality.With a variety of roles and tones to choose from, AI's chatbots have proven popular with users between the ages of 18 and 24, who accounted for about 60% of the website's traffic, according to Similarweb statistics. In contrast to other AI chatbots like Google's Bard and OpenAI's ChatGPT, the firm is positioning itself as the supplier of more enjoyable personal AI companions thanks in part to this demography.


In the first six months after its inception, the corporation claimed that 100 million monthly visits had been made to their website.


Morality.According to insiders, AI is also in discussions with venture capital investors to obtain equity money, which could put the company's valuation beyond $5 billion. At a $1 billion valuation, it received $150 million in a fundraising round headed by Andreessen Horowitz in March.


The individuals, who asked to remain anonymous because the conversations are confidential, claimed that the talks with Google are still continuing and that the terms of the agreement might alter.


In addition to its previous stock investment, Google has been investing in AI firms. It has paid $2 billion in convertible notes to model manufacturer Anthropic. Anthropic makes advantage of both the most recent TPU version from Google and its cloud services.


That is a part of a recent trend in which major cloud service providers, such as Microsoft with its investments in OpenAI and Google and Amazon with their bets on Anthropic, are making deals with AI companies to entice them to use specific cloud or hardware in the computer-intensive ethnic background to build models and serve consumers.


At a San Francisco event last week, US Federal Trade Commission head Lina Khan said that the agency is investigating cloud providers' involvement in AI firms to check for any anti-competitive practices.
